The original Goeff Bougourd studio at Haunch of Venison Yard.

In the late 1980s the first Apple Mac computers signaled to the forward thinking that change was on the way. At this point Geoff Bougourd worked out of (Admiral Lord) Nelson's former home just off London's Bond Street. Now the home of the avant-garde gallery, Haunch Of Venison.

Nelson House was filled by Bougourd with some of the most talented in design, illustration, photography and fashion magazine production. Designers for the music industry The Design Corporation, Photographers; Nick Clements, Corrine Day and many others all found homes there during that period as well as cutting edge fashion magazine Unique (the first men's fashion publication in 1980s London). Those people have now all developed into international players in the world of design and photography.
